Is a Tankless Water Heater Right for Your Ramsey Home?

A tankless water heater, often called an on-demand heater, operates differently than the bulky unit you likely have in your basement right now. Instead of maintaining a reservoir of hot water, it uses a powerful heat exchanger to warm water only as it passes through the unit. Understanding how tankless water heaters work is the first step in deciding if this upgrade fits your lifestyle. For many families in our community, the decision to invest in a tankless water heater installation in Ramsey comes down to reliability. You won't have to worry about being the last person to the shower and finding only lukewarm water left.

Traditional tanks suffer from what we call "standby loss." This means your heater turns on periodically throughout the night to keep 50 gallons of water hot, even while you're asleep. It's a constant drain on your utility budget. Tankless systems eliminate this waste entirely. Beyond monthly savings, these units are a long-term investment. While a standard tank usually lasts between 10 and 12 years before the risk of a leak becomes a major concern, a well-maintained tankless system can easily provide service for 20 years or more.

Tank vs. Tankless: The Core Differences

Switching systems requires a shift in how you think about your water supply. With a tank, you're limited by storage capacity; with a tankless unit, we look at the flow rate, measured in Gallons Per Minute (GPM). This change allows you to reclaim significant floor space. Since these units are wall-mounted, you can finally use that corner of the utility room for storage or extra shelving. It's a cleaner, more modern approach to home mechanicals that fits perfectly in finished North Metro basements.

The Minnesota Winter Challenge

Our local climate presents a unique hurdle for water heating. In Ramsey, winter groundwater temperatures can drop to approximately 40°F. This means your heater has to work much harder to reach a comfortable 120°F compared to a unit in a warmer state. This is known as "temperature rise." Because of this 80-degree gap, a professional tankless water heater installation in Ramsey is essential. Generic sizing won't work here. You need a system calibrated to handle high demand when the intake water is at its coldest.

Sizing Your Tankless System for Ramsey Ground Water

Sizing a water heater in Minnesota is a different science than it is in warmer climates. When you plan a tankless water heater installation in Ramsey, we don't just look at the number of bathrooms in your home. We calculate the "peak demand" based on the coldest day of the year. This ensures that your "endless hot water" doesn't turn into a lukewarm trickle when you need it most. The energy efficiency of tankless water heaters is only realized when the unit is properly matched to the local environment.

The process follows four critical steps. First, we calculate your peak demand by adding up every fixture that might run simultaneously. Second, we determine the required temperature rise. In Ramsey, our winter groundwater averages about 40°F. To reach a standard 120°F, your system must jump 80 degrees instantly. Third, we match the unit's Gallons Per Minute (GPM) rating specifically to that 80-degree rise. Finally, we choose the fuel source. While electric and propane are options, natural gas is almost always the preferred choice for high-demand homes in the North Metro due to its heating power.

Calculating Your Gallons Per Minute (GPM)

To understand your needs, we look at standard flow rates. A typical shower uses 2.0 GPM, a kitchen faucet uses 1.0 GPM, and a dishwasher requires about 1.5 GPM. If you want to run two showers and the dishwasher at once, you need a system that handles 5.5 GPM. It is vital to remember that a unit advertised as "9 GPM" in a Florida climate might only deliver 4.5 GPM during a Ramsey winter because of the massive temperature gap it must overcome. GPM represents the volume of water the unit can heat to your desired temperature based on the specific 80-degree rise required during a Ramsey winter.

Gas vs. Electric Tankless Units

In the Twin Cities, high-output gas units are the industry standard for whole-home use. They provide the high BTU (British Thermal Unit) input necessary to flash-heat water during a blizzard. Electric units, while compact, often require a 200-amp or even 300-amp electrical service to function. Many older Ramsey homes aren't equipped for that kind of load without a costly panel upgrade. Natural gas also offers better reliability during winter storms, ensuring you have hot water even if the power flickers. The Installation Process: What to Expect in Ramsey

A professional tankless water heater installation in Ramsey involves several technical upgrades that go beyond a simple plumbing swap. Because these units heat water instantly, they require a much higher energy input than a traditional tank. We start by assessing your existing gas lines; most standard tanks operate on about 40,000 BTUs, while a whole-home tankless unit can demand up to 199,000 BTUs. This significant difference means your home's infrastructure must be ready to support the load. According to the U.S. Department of Energy, Tankless or Demand-Type Water Heaters provide efficient service only when the installation environment is correctly prepared.

Our team handles the water line reconfiguration to adapt your plumbing to the new wall-mounted location. This often involves moving pipes from the floor level to the wall, which helps reclaim that valuable floor space mentioned earlier. We also install a condensate management system. High-efficiency condensing models produce a small amount of acidic runoff during operation. This runoff must be safely neutralized and drained according to local Ramsey plumbing codes to protect your home's pipes. Finally, we perform gas pressure calibration and rigorous testing to ensure the unit fires correctly every time you turn on a tap.

Why Gas Line Sizing Matters

When a tankless unit "starves" for fuel, it can lead to performance issues or cause the burners to fail. This happens if the gas pipe is too narrow to deliver the volume of fuel required for that 199,000 BTU surge. Ramsey municipal codes are very specific about gas line modifications to prevent these safety hazards. We verify that your existing gas meter and internal piping can handle the increased demand. Venting for Cold Climates

Venting is where many generic installations fail in Minnesota. Traditional tanks vent through metal chimneys, but high-efficiency tankless units use specialized PVC concentric venting. This system uses a single pipe-within-a-pipe design to pull fresh air in while pushing exhaust out. It's a critical safety feature that prevents the unit from using up the oxygen inside your home. Proper vent termination is vital to prevent ice buildup during -20°F Ramsey nights. If a vent becomes blocked by frost or icicles, the system will shut down for your safety.
